Influenza returns to Yucatan; vaccinations urged for vulnerable

So far in this pre-winter season there have been 13 confirmed cases of influenza in Yucatan…//

The National System of Epidemiological Surveillance (Sinave) points out that although so far no deaths have been reported from this disease recently, it claimed the lives of 39 people in Yucatan last winter season.

Nationwide, Sinave reports that 267 cases of influenza with 9 deaths have been recorded; the state of Veracruz is where most deaths have occurred due to complications of the illness, as well as confirmed cases, followed by Chiapas with two deaths.

The majority of cases have been influenza A H1N1, followed by influenza type B.

The Ministry of Health of Yucatan (SSY) already has the necessary vaccines to prevent influenza in the state, so the vulnerable population is asked to go to health centers to access the vaccination.

He said that the population of adults over 66 years, children under 6 years, people with chronic diseases and pregnant women are those who must obtain the vaccine on a mandatory basis.

Other preventive measures include, antibacterial gel, as well as hand washing and covering the face when sneezing.
